Sui Ecosystem Projects

Four grant-funded projects showcase ecosystem diversity:

ProjectCategoryInnovation Highlights
SUIASocialFiNFT-based social network with 200K+ users
ComingChatMulti-chainIntegrated Web3 portal with AI features
MovEXDeFiHybrid AMM+orderbook DEX
MovernanceGovernanceOn-chain voting with bribery-resistant framework

IEO Participation Details

ExchangeAllocationKey Dates (UTC+8)Eligibility
KuCoin225M SUIApril 15-22Non-China users
Bybit940M SUIApril 21-24Global (ex-China)
OKX225M SUIApril 23-24Includes China

FAQ

Q: Why no SUI token airdrop?
A: The team prioritized whitelist rewards for active contributors over broad distribution.

Q: How does Sui's scalability compare to competitors?
A: Its parallel processing architecture offers superior throughput to conventional blockchains.

Q: What's the long-term value proposition of SUI tokens?
A: Combined staking rewards, governance rights, and utility in a growing ecosystem.

Q: Can China-based investors participate?
A: Only through OKX's JumpStart platform (April 23-24).

Q: How does the storage fund benefit token holders?
A: It stabilizes network fees long-term while rewarding data maintainers.

Q: What are Sui's main risks?
A: Adoption hurdles and potential over-reliance on technical merits over community building.
